GAT delivery model

One line of accountability from problem to production

Whether the engagement is a fixed-scope implementation or ongoing ownership, senior discovery, architecture, and hands-on delivery stay connected throughout the work.

  1. 01

    Frame the operating constraint

    Start with the stalled handoff, missed revenue, service backlog, unreliable forecast, or manual control, not a preselected feature list.

  2. 02

    Map the real workflow

    Put the people, decisions, records, platforms, exceptions, and ownership on one page before deciding what Salesforce or AI should do.

  3. 03

    Build the smallest complete system

    Deliver the data model, automation, integrations, reporting, controls, and release path needed for the workflow to hold together in production.

  4. 04

    Make it operable by the team

    Validate with users, document the decisions, train the owners, and measure the workflow after launch so the system can improve instead of calcify.

Operating principles

What stays true

One practice stays accountable

Discovery, architecture, and core delivery remain connected. The GAT practice hearing the business problem is accountable for how it becomes a working system.

Architecture follows operating reality

A clean diagram is not enough. The design has to survive exceptions, permissions, reporting needs, team habits, and the systems already in place.

AI earns a specific job

Use AI where judgment or unstructured context matters. Keep stable rules deterministic, make consequential actions reviewable, and measure the workflow instead of the demo.
